Upskilling the board has become imperative in today’s corporate governance landscape, but have companies fully embraced this need? In this episode of Inside Today’s Boardrooms, Patricia Galloway, Board Chair at Pegasus-Global Holdings, Inc., and Board Member at Stantec and Granite Construction, offers invaluable insights and practical guidance for companies seeking to enhance the skills of their board members through ongoing education and certification programs.
